A Fighting Honor

Another day, another battle Nothing ever matter Only thing I can handle Is to be a lone wanderer All I can do is just to fight Hardly anything on my mind Strength is my only might Justice is what to search and find What else can I dare to prove? Staying to become right and noble Warrior's leadership - a will not to lose Remaining to defend and be honorable A desire that burns so high Into a protecting feeling, I can't deny A true fighting honor Sheer pure skill, in which I was taught
